اذهب الي المحتوي
أوفيسنا

نموذج فاتورة مبيعات


abua

الردود الموصى بها

السلام عليكم ورحمة الله وبركاته

اخوتي الاكارم ..

انشأت تطبيق لمحلي التجاري وانشأت الجداول وباقي كائنات التطبيق وباقي بعض التعديلات واضافة تقارير وما الى ذلك

مشكلتي هي في نموذج الفاتورة والذي لم اتمكن من حلها رغم المحاولات ورغم مراجعة الدروس الا انني لم اتوصل الى الحل

فلجأت اليكم لعلي اجد ضالتي :

1. عندما اختار كود الصنف احتاج ان يضاف اسم الصنف تلقائيا علما انني طبقتها في نموذج ( بيع اصناف ) ونموذج ( شراء اصناف ) الا

    ان هذه الخاصية لا تعمل مع الفاتورة .

2 . اجمالي الفاتورة يكون مكررا في نموذج الفاتورة والمطلوب ان يكون حقل واحد مستقل يعطيني اجمالي الفاتورة  .

3. احتاج اضافة فقرة في نموذج الفاتورة وهو ( اجمالي حساب العميل ) واضافة  ( تسديد المبالغ من قبل العميل ) لتطرح من حسابه

    الكلي ويعطيني ( حساب الديون المتبقية عليه ) .

ارفق لكم ما قمت به وانتظر من حضراتكم الردود مدعومة بالحلول والطرق التي يجب علي اتباعها لانهي برنامجي ولكم مني وافر التقدير والاحترام .

Database2.zip

رابط هذا التعليق
شارك

في 12/10/2017 at 23:50, abua said:

1. عندما اختار كود الصنف احتاج ان يضاف اسم الصنف تلقائيا علما انني طبقتها في نموذج ( بيع اصناف ) ونموذج ( شراء اصناف ) الا

    ان هذه الخاصية لا تعمل مع الفاتورة .

لهذه الفقرة انت تحتاج هذا 

Private Sub كود_الصنف_AfterUpdate()
    Me.اسم_الصنف = Me.كود_الصنف.Column(1)
End Sub

 

في 12/10/2017 at 23:50, abua said:

2 . اجمالي الفاتورة يكون مكررا في نموذج الفاتورة والمطلوب ان يكون حقل واحد مستقل يعطيني اجمالي الفاتورة  .

وبدل حقل خليت المربع الاجمالي في اسفل النموذج الفرعي
واضفت مربع نص اخر في نموذج رئيسي و مصدره صار مربع المجموع في نموذج الفرعي

=[بيع اصناف نموذج فرعي].[Form]![MySum]

 

في 12/10/2017 at 23:50, abua said:

3. احتاج اضافة فقرة في نموذج الفاتورة وهو ( اجمالي حساب العميل ) واضافة  ( تسديد المبالغ من قبل العميل ) لتطرح من حسابه

    الكلي ويعطيني ( حساب الديون المتبقية عليه ) .

سنستخدم دالة DSum مع الشروط لكي نعرف حساب اجمال لكل عميل لكن هناك نحن نحتاج جدول اخر لتسديد الديون و تاريخ الدفع وهذا خليت لك لكي تعمله انت 
واذا احتاجت شيء نحن هنا
 

Database2.zip

  • Like 2
رابط هذا التعليق
شارك

  • 2 weeks later...

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information